Closed-End Fund ⚫ Consists of a fixed number of shares that are traded in the same way as the shares of any other company ⚫ The share price tends to be less than the NAV calculated from the market value of the investments Risk Management and Financial Institutions 3e, Chapter 4, Copyright © John C. Exchange-Traded Funds (ETFs, page 71) ⚫ Often designed to track an index ⚫ Started by an institutional investor that deposits a block of securities and obtains shares in the fund ⚫ Shares are traded on an exchange ⚫ Large institutional investors can exchange shares in the fund for the underlying assets, and vice versa ⚫ This keeps the share price close to the NAV of the fund’s investments Risk Management and Financial Institutions 3e, Chapter 4, Copyright © John C.
